    Abstract: An airbag restraint device for occupants of a vehicle, and including an airbag system having an airbag module with an inflatable airbag. A cover at least partially covers the airbag and has a tear seam via which the airbag, upon inflation, can expand outwardly. A force-concentrating arrangement concentrates the opening force of the expanding airbag onto the tear seam, and comprises a structure extending around the airbag and having two opposite ends. The structure is folded over to form two layers and to bring the ends together at the tear seam, where the ends are connected to the cover. One of the ends is provided with a plurality of spaced-apart, strip-shaped members extending away from that end and sewn directly to the tear seam to form tear strips that upon expansion of the airbag tear defined, spaced-apart holes into the tear seam for a defined further opening thereof. The layers of the structure are disposed next to or parallel to one another.

    Abstract: A rack and pinion steering gear comprising a thrust element disposed in a housing for pressing a rack and pinion against one another. One side of the thrust element is supported against the rack, and another side is supported against a wedge-like part formed of two semi-circular annular elements, each of which is provided with at least one wedge surface that is disposed at an angle to a central plane of the wedge-like part. A side of the wedge-like part remote from the thrust element is supported against a set screw. The thrust element and/or the set screw is provided with an inclined surface that cooperates with the at least one wedge surface of the annular elements of the wedge-like part.

    Abstract: Exhaust gas post treatment system for nitrogen oxide and particle reduction of an internal combustion engines operated with excess air. An oxidation catalytic converter is disposed in the exhaust gas stream of the engine for converting at least a portion of the nitric oxide of the exhaust gas into nitrogen dioxide. A metering device adds reduction agent to the exhaust gas stream downstream of the oxidation catalytic converter and/or to a partial exhaust gas stream branched off upstream of the oxidation catalytic converter and returned to the exhaust gas stream downstream thereof. The reduction agent is ammonia or a material that releases ammonia downstream of the supply location due to the hot exhaust gas.

    Abstract: An exhaust gas system for an internal combustion engine, comprising an oxidation catalytic converter disposed in a first exhaust gas manifold section with which the exhaust gas outlets of a first portion of the cylinders communicate, and a hydrolysis catalytic converter disposed in a second exhaust gas manifold section with which the exhaust gas outlets of the remaining portion of the cylinders communicate. The hydrolysis catalytic converter, together with the oxidation catalytic converter that annularly surrounds it, are installed in a common housing. A tubular portion of the second exhaust gas manifold section extends into the housing and accommodates the hydrolysis catalytic converter in its end portion. A tubular portion of a first exhaust gas manifold section surrounds the tubular portion of the second exhaust gas manifold section, resulting in an annular in-flow chamber for the oxidation catalytic converter that simultaneously serves as a heating chamber.
